About Marilyn C. Henderson

Marilyn C. Henderson is a scholar working on Pharmacology, Physiology and Biochemistry, having authored 53 papers that have together received 1.9k indexed citations. Recurring topics across this work include Pharmacogenetics and Drug Metabolism (20 papers), Drug-Induced Hepatotoxicity and Protection (7 papers) and Reproductive biology and impacts on aquatic species (6 papers). The work is most often cited by research in Pharmacology (865 citations), Health, Toxicology and Mutagenesis (445 citations) and Physiology (142 citations). Marilyn C. Henderson has collaborated with scholars based in United States, Canada and Ireland. Frequent co-authors include Donald R. Buhler, C. L. Miranda, Jan F. Stevens, Max L. Deinzer, Sharon K. Krueger, Lisbeth K. Siddens, David E. Williams, Cristobal L. Miranda, David E. Williams and David W. Barnes. Their work appears in journals such as Biochemical and Biophysical Research Communications, Chemosphere and Journal of Pharmacology and Experimental Therapeutics.
